Meaning & origin
Ananiah is a modern, rare feminine name that first appeared in U.S. birth records in 2002. Its peak popularity came in 2014, though even then it remained uncommon. The name's trajectory has been rising since 2021, suggesting a recent uptick in interest. While its derivation is uncertain, it likely echoes the biblical Hananiah, giving it a spiritual resonance that appeals to parents seeking a contemporary yet traditional-sounding name. With a 1-in-267,878 frequency in its latest recorded year (2022), Ananiah remains a distinctive choice, reflecting a broader trend of inventive, -iah-ending names in American naming culture.
Ananiah is a modern coinage, likely a feminine variation of the biblical name Hananiah, which appears in the Hebrew Bible. The name follows a contemporary pattern of adding the suffix -iah to create a melodious, religious-sounding name. Its use in the United States began in the early 2000s, and it has been given exclusively to girls in the available data.
